KYOWVA’S MISSION
STATEMENT
By Dr. Hoyt W. Allen, Jr.
Our MISSION is to
fulfill the Great
Commission of Jesus
(Matthew 28:18-20),
within a reasonable
radius of Ironton,
OH, by planting new
churches and
assisting
congregations which
are consistent with
Restoration Movement
principles.
We believe that
every community
should have at least
one New Testament
congregation by
which people can
have the opportunity
to hear the gospel
of Jesus Christ, and
then obey it by
becoming a
Christian. The local
church is able to
extend a fellowship
which every soul
needs to experience.
It is the goal of
KYOWVA to not only
plant new
congregations, but
to assist in
educating the
brethren and share
in various
outreaches, so that
they will become
more productive
workers for the
local church.
It is the hope of
KYOWVA supporters
that from the new
congregations which
KYOWVA “mothers” as
well as the older
congregations which
are assisted, young
people will grow up
and serve our Lord
in their youthful
years as well as
during the rest of
their lives.
